Sports Day of Girls’ Senior Section

The Sports Day of I.T.H.S Girls’ Section (class 6-8) took place on Saturday, 03 March. On a bright morning, at the arrival of spring, students kept coming from 8.00 a.m. to the field of the main campus to join in the events of the annual sports.
 The concerned teacher Ms. Kainath Chowdhurry, organizer for the events, received the children one by one.  A good number of interesting track and field games and sports were in the list: 100 m, 200 m, 400 m, 1600 m races, suicide run, long jump, relay race, sack race were among all. 
It started at around 10.00 am formally. Each event students securing 1st, 2nd and 3rd position were applauded and the class-wise competitions gained more enthusiasm by the spectators. Students’ impulsiveness was overpowering. Especially the total turn out from class 7B and Prep Class was appreciated. The most attention-grabbing events of the day were the sack race and bucket-filling games among all the teachers of our section. The cheering students burst into playful fun as the events were going on. 
Head of Section Mr. Yavuz Koca and Turkish Language teacher Mr. Lutfi Ak were present with other teachers to give students morale and encouragement. The sports day ended peacefully in fun and high spirits.

Second Bangla Olympiad Held at Int'l Turkish Hope School

Second Bangla Olympiad Competition and prize distribution ceremony held at the main campus of International Turkish Hope School on 25th February, 2012.  The program also hosted distinguished guests including Mr. Jinnat Imtiaz Ali -  Prof. of Linguistics University of Dhaka as Chief Guest, Mr Helal Morshed - Chairman of Bangladesh Freedom Fighters Council as Special Guest and  HE  Mr. Vakur Erkul - Ambassador of the Republic of Turkey to Bangladesh as Guest of Honour. Prof. Dr. Farrukh Ahmed – Chairman of Turkish Language Department Dhaka University, Mr. Adnan Ozturk First Secretary of the Turkish Embassy in Bangladesh, Mr. Murray Keeler – Head of Examinations British Council. Initially around 900 students participated in this Bangla Olympiad from all its branches of International Turkish Hope School. Competition held in five categories, in two groups. Essay, Painting, Poem Recitation, Singing for Bangladeshi Students & Singing for Foreign Students.

Turkish Language Olympiads in ITHS Girls Section

ITHS Girls Senior Section, Turkish Language Teachers organized a mini-Turkish Olympiads to encourage to students engage in Turkish Language. Many students from class6 to 8 participated in the competition which had singing and reciting poem categories. Having been trained regularly for two months after school-time, the students were observed to be so excited and also determined to perform since the winner will have the great chance of going to Turkey to represent Bangladesh in 10th International Turkish Olympiads. After the heart-beating time for jury marking for all the competitors, the results were announced. Senior Deputy Head Mr. Idris Koken has handed over the presents to the winners and congratulated them on their outstanding performances.
